Full Job Posting
Overview
- We are seeking a qualified Warehouse Operations Candidate with a technical background in chemical engineering or petrochemical to manage warehouse operations for chemical and petrochemical products.
- This role combines hands on warehouse management with technical expertise to ensure safe storage, handling, compliance, and efficient distribution of hazardous materials.
- The ideal candidate will support daily warehouse operations and leverage their engineering knowledge to improve processes, mitigate risks, and maintain the highest standards of safety and regulatory compliance.
Responsibilities
- Oversee daily warehouse operations, including receiving, storing, picking, packing, and shipping of chemical and petrochemical products.
- Ensure proper segregation, labeling, and storage of hazardous materials in accordance with international standards (e.g., HAZMAT, OSHA, GHS, and local regulations).
- Conduct risk assessments, implement safety protocols, and lead incident investigations.
- Optimize warehouse layout, inventory management systems, and material flow using engineering principles to improve efficiency, reduce costs, and minimize exposure risks.
- Manage inventory accuracy through cycle counts, reconciliation, and implementation of ERP/WMS systems tailored for chemical tracking.
- Coordinate with production, procurement, logistics, and quality teams to ensure timely and compliant material availability.
- Develop and enforce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s).
- Monitor environmental controls for sensitive chemical products and troubleshoot technical issues.
- Train and supervise warehouse staff on safe chemical handling, PPE usage, emergency response, and engineering best practices.
- Prepare reports on key performance indicators (KPIs) such as throughput, accuracy, safety incidents, and operational efficiency.
- Support continuous improvement initiatives, including process automation, lean warehousing techniques, and sustainability efforts.
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s Degree in Chemical Engineering, Petrochemical Engineering, or a closely related field is mandatory.
- Minimum 2 years of experience in warehouse operations, logistics, or plant operations within the chemical, petrochemical, oil & gas, or related process industries.
- Strong understanding of chemical properties, compatibility, reactivity, and safe handling practices.
- Proven knowledge of relevant regulations and standards (OSHA, EPA, DOT, IMDG, ISO 14001, etc.).
- Experience with Warehouse Management Systems (WMS), ERP software (e.g., Tally), and inventory optimization tools.
- Certification in hazardous materials handling (e.g., HAZMAT, forklift, or relevant safety certifications) is highly preferred.
